Supreme Court collegium clears 4 advocates to be elevated as judges of Telangana high court, 1 for Andhra Pradesh HC
HYDERABAD: The Supreme Court collegium headed by Chief Justice B R Gavai on Thursday cleared the names of four advocates to be elevated as judges of the Telangana high court. These names sent by the high court a year ago were cleared now. The collegium released a note on Thursday saying that it met on July 2 and approved the proposal to elevate them. The four advocates whose names were cleared and sent to the central govt are Gouse Meera Mohiuddin, Chalapathi Rao Suddala, Vakiti Ramakrishna Reddy and Gadi Praveen Kumar. Praveen is currently working as deputy solicitor general at the high court. AP advocate G Tuhin Kumar’s name was cleared for AP high court.These new judges will take charge after notification by the central govt.
